64GB DDR4 2666 ECC registered DIMM with 288 pins, CL19 latency and 1.2V operation for server and workstation upgrades
This 64GB DDR4 2666 registered DIMM provides error-correcting memory for servers and workstations that require ECC protection. It operates at 1.20V with CL19 latency and uses a 288-pin form factor. The module is built with major-brand chips and 3DS/TSV packaging for high-density capacity.
Registered buffering reduces electrical load on the memory controller, allowing stable operation in multi-module server configurations. ECC functionality detects and corrects single-bit errors to protect data integrity. The 288-pin DIMM interface fits standard DDR4 server slots. Major-brand chipset components undergo quality-assurance testing for dependable performance.
The 2S2Rx4 (4Rx4 3DS/TSV) rank structure delivers 64GB in a single module through 3D-stacked die technology. This high-density organisation suits platforms that support 3DS/TSV registered DIMMs. Systems without 3DS/TSV support will not recognise the full capacity.

Yes, the module runs at DDR4 2666 MHz which corresponds to the PC4-21300 bandwidth rating; actual throughput will not exceed that specification.
It fits a standard DDR4 DIMM socket with 288 pins; the registered design adds a buffer chip so the motherboard must support registered ECC memory.
Align the off-centre notch on the 288-pin edge connector with the key in the DDR4 slot, press straight down until both retention clips click, and verify the module sits evenly — the notch offset is the step most people get wrong.
